Kiosk and Visitor ExperienceAmbassador
May include manning a station at the Kiosk or Education Center to make public contacts, including answering general questions about Big Morongo Canyon Preserve and its plant and animal species and providing assistance with special events and staffing info tables. Some positions include processing sales of logo merchandise.
Bird Walk Leader
Must have excellent visual and/or auditory bird identification skills to assist in biweekly bird walks. Walk the trails and help the public with the identification of several species of birds. May assist with statistical analysis of bird count numbers.
Trails and Maintenance
Includes sweeping; picking up litter; installation/maintenance of interpretive signs; clearing the trail of vegetation using a variety of tools including hand pruner and loppers, shovels, McLeods, etc. May also use blowers, weed eaters, mowers, chippers, chainsaws. Must wear proper Personal Protective Equipment (PPE) including gloves and eye protection before using any of these tools.
Education Docents
Attend special training to become a Docent (student tour leader); Participate in outdoor educational programs for school-age children,  Work with the education committee to design engaging, place-based education programs that explore science and cultural history.
Interpretive Hike Leader
Attend training to learn or enhance topic knowledge to lead interpretive hikes on the trails. Must be knowledgeable in the subject matter and be able to answer the public’s questions. May also assist in assessing trail condition and reporting it back to hosts.
Native Plant and Pollinator Garden
Maintain the different gardens, plants, and irrigation systems.  Keep the paths cleared and raked.  Tend to the water feature.
